Average Cost To Move From AZ to CT
Moving costs can vary based on how much you're moving, the exact distance between your current home and your new one, and any extra services you might need (like packing or storage). On average, a 2,431 mile move from Arizona to Connecticut, might range anywhere from $2,872–$11,016.
Here's a quick look at estimated costs based on home size:
| Home Size | Estimated Cost |
|---|---|
| 1 Bedroom | $2,872 - $5,532 |
| 2 Bedrooms | $3,454 - $6,513 |
| 3 Bedrooms | $4,956 - $7,555 |
| 4 Bedrooms | $6,428 - $10,776 |
| 5 Bedrooms | $7,685 - $11,016 |

Climate
Summers in Arizona average 99°F, which is warmer than Connecticut's average of 83°F. If you're moving from Arizona to Connecticut, you might be looking forward to a slightly milder summer climate. This can mean lower cooling bills, more comfortable outdoor activities, and less intense heat overall.
Economic Opportunities
Connecticut is home to industries in real estate and rental and leasing ($40 billion), finance and insurance ($37.7 billion), and professional and business services ($33.7 billion), which means lots of job opportunities if you work in one of those fields.
The average income in Connecticut is $90,213, so you might earn a higher salary than in Arizona, which has an average income of $72,581.

Fun & Recreation
There's lots to do in Connecticut, including outdoor recreation opportunities at Cove Island Park, Tarrywile Park & Mansion, and Seaside Park. For the arts and culture enthusiasts, Connecticut has plenty of spots like Mystic Seaport Museum, The Mark Twain House & Museum, and Yale University Art Gallery.
Sports enthusiasts can cheer on Connecticut Sun (WNBA), Bridgeport Islanders (AHL), and Hartford Wolf Pack (AHL), and families and single people alike can get to know the state by visiting Mystic Seaport, Historic Ship Nautilus & Submarine Force Museum, and Lake Compounce Amusement Park.

Tips for Moving From Arizona to Connecticut
- Start planning early. Book your movers at least four to six weeks ahead, especially in peak season.
- Purge what you don't need. Save space and money by downsizing before the move.
- Label everything clearly. If you're doing the packing, labeling boxes by room and types of items will make setting up your new home in Connecticut that much easier.
- Get established in your new town. Look into DMV locations, utilities, and healthcare providers ahead of time.
